I got a shimano tekota 500 about a year ago, and considered it the most reliable reel I've ever owned. But yesterday the drag failed badly---if I turned the handle when there was moderate pressure on the end of the line, the drag would immediately slip to almost nothing. After losing 3 fish, I gave up. So, I guess that means it's maintenance time...

Since it doesn't seem likely that I'll get the new drag washers right away, I went ahead and took the reel apart and cleaned it up following the master's instructions (OK, I skipped the levelwind parts---I'll do that next time, I promise...). It didn't take long and the only thing that took even a few minutes thought was figuring out this when re-assembling:
 
make sure the yoke plate (key #381) is in the "up" position

Anyways, it's working much better now and definitely should have done it sooner. Some of the screws on the handle-side were loose, and I'd never touched those. There was some crude around the drag and that was the source of the problem. I can't wait to get the new drag washers. Having had it apart once, it'll be a piece of cake to replace those.
